Goa Dairy and its cup of sorrows

It isheartening to know that Dairy is celebrating its Golden Jubilee (1971-2021).Till a few years back, it was the leading and most conspicuous brand in Goa.Besides milk, it produced ghee, curd, lassi and flavoured milk. Nowadays,except for milk, the other items are a rarity. Somewhere down the years, GDlost its sheen and there are several reasons for it: infighting in themanagement committee, bad pricing paid to dairy farmers, cost of fodder, oldmachinery, alleged scams and most importantly competition from neighbouringstates. Interestingly, GD was desperate to stop Amul’s entry in Goa, but thelate CM Manohar Parrikar did not approve of the move. With its expertise offive decades, GD could have taken up the challenge to have a pan-Indiandistribution like Amul or Mother Dairy. Without crying over spilled milk, evennow GD could put its house in order. The management members need to thinkbeyond their personal interests and egos.
